Secure Viewing: Ligature-Resistant TV Enclosures for Behavioral Health
Ensuring patient well-being in behavioral mental health environments is essential, and television access often presents a potential risk . Ligature-resistant TV cabinets offer a proven approach for mitigating this concern. These specially designed units reduce the ability to create a hanging loop around the display , providing reassurance for professionals and a safer viewing experience for individuals in care.

{Ligature Secure TV Enclosures: A Handbook for Hospital Facilities
Protecting patients within hospital settings is paramount, and TV safety presents a critical concern. Ligature dangers associated with conventional televisions are well-documented, leading to the development of specialized, ligature anti-ligature TV enclosures . These robust units are designed to deter the possibility of patient-assisted ligature attempts . Choosing the appropriate enclosure involves considering several factors , including footprint, placement options, durability , and meeting with relevant safety guidelines . Proper choice can dramatically increase patient security.
- Assess the particular needs of your location.
- Review multiple enclosure layouts.
- Confirm adherence with national codes .
- Enforce awareness programs for staff .
